Output e58af97f6f2e63cd175fc2f10ea4515d9b55f7e0662ff9a64e219faba1d01e57:1

value
1407415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 debaa4835d39f5383b799e29839acf6414fdf026 OP_EQUAL
address
3MzhXHctrUGLNENwmSg2wL5LAJB2wLUN1t
transaction
e58af97f6f2e63cd175fc2f10ea4515d9b55f7e0662ff9a64e219faba1d01e57
spent
true